Do’s And Don’ts In Case Of Water Damage
Though water gives life, water invasion on parts where it's not supposed to be can cause damage. It can peel off away surfaces and erode the structure if the water saturates right into your structure. Mold as well as mildew also thrive in a wet setting, which can be harmful for your health and wellness. Houses with water damage scent old as well as moldy.

Water can come from several sources such as typhoons, floods, ruptured pipes, leakages, and sewer problems. In case you experience water damages, it would certainly be good to understand some safety and security preventative measures. Here are a few guidelines on exactly how to take care of water damage.

Do Prioritize House Insurance Policy Insurance Coverage



Water damages from flooding as a result of hefty winds is seasonal. However, you can additionally experience an abrupt flooding when a faulty pipeline instantly breaks right into your residence. It would certainly be best to have house insurance that covers both acts of God such as all-natural calamities, as well as emergency situations like damaged plumbing.

Do Not Forget to Shut Off Energies



This reduces off power to your whole home, stopping electrical shocks when water comes in as it is a conductor. Don't forget to turn off the major water line shutoff.

Do Stay Proactive and Heed Climate Informs



Listen to evacuation warnings if you live near a river, creek, or lake . Doing so minimizes prospective home damage.

Don't Disregard the Roofing System



You can stay clear of rainfall damages if there are no holes as well as leaks in your roof covering. This will certainly stop water from streaming down your walls and saturating your ceiling.

Do Take Notice Of Tiny Leaks



A ruptured pipeline doesn't take place over night. Typically, there are red flags that show you have actually deteriorated pipes in your house. For example, you might observe bubbling paint, peeling off wallpaper, water touches, water stains, or trickling sounds behind the wall surfaces. Ultimately, this pipeline will certainly burst. Preferably, you need to not wait for things to rise. Have your plumbing fixed before it causes substantial damage.

Don't Panic in Case of a Burst Pipeline



Keeping your presence of mind is essential in a time of situation. Stressing will just compound the trouble due to the fact that it will certainly suppress you from acting quick. When it pertains to water damage, timing is essential. The longer you wait, the even more damage you can expect. Therefore, if a pipe bursts in your residence, promptly turned off your major water shutoff to remove the resource. Unplug all electric outlets in the location or transform off the circuit breaker for that component of the residence. Call a respectable water damage remediation professional for aid.

The Dos and Don’ts if you Face a Water Damage


What to do immediately




  • Immediately turn off the source of water to stop further damage


  • The breaker should also be turned off in the damaged area


  • Switch of any electrical devices that may be in the affected area


  • Lift up draperies and put a pin on the furniture skirts to prevent them from getting wet


  • Remove things from the carpet that may leave stains such as newspaper, books, plants, baskets etc.


  • If you have home insurance, call up the company to send someone to assess the damage


  • If you are removing stuff before their arrival, click photographs so that they can assess the damage


  • Call up a reliable water damage restoration company. They are proficient in handling such situations which helps minimize damage


  • Move any valuable stuff such as paintings, art work, photographs etc from the damaged area.


  • Remove any small furniture from the wet area and move to dry, safe regions


  • Wipe furniture and open drawers to enable quick drying

  • What you should not do




  • Never try to use home vacuum cleaners to dry wet areas. You may get an electric shock


  • Do not walk on the wet area more than necessary as it may cause water to spread in the dry areas


  • Never try to dry wet areas using newspapers. Its ink spreads fast and may aggravate damage


  • Never switch on TV or other electrical appliances on the wet carpet or floor


  • Do not use HVAC system if it has been affected by water


  • Do not disturb visible mold. It is best treated by professionals
